More than 1.7 million evacuated as Typhoon Bavi makes landfall in China

Typhoon Bavi, a powerful storm that recently made landfall in China, has triggered the evacuation of more than 1.7 million people. Despite being downgraded from a super typhoon, Bavi remains a significant threat due to its potential to cause widespread damage and disruption.

Meteorologists have been closely monitoring the typhoon as it approached China’s coast. Initially classified as a super typhoon, Bavi’s intense winds and heavy rainfall posed a serious risk to life and property. Although the storm has now been downgraded, experts warn it remains dangerous, capable of causing floods, landslides, and destruction.

Authorities in the affected regions acted swiftly to minimize the impact by ordering mass evacuations. More than 1.7 million residents were moved to safer locations, including emergency shelters and other secure facilities. These efforts aim to protect vulnerable communities from the typhoon’s powerful effects.

Transportation and industrial activities in the typhoon’s path were severely disrupted as precautionary measures were put in place. Ports, airports, and railway services faced delays or temporary closures to ensure the safety of passengers and workers.

Local governments have been mobilizing emergency workers, deploying rescue teams, and stockpiling supplies to assist populations in the hardest-hit areas. Food, water, medical supplies, and essential equipment have been distributed to support evacuees and emergency responders.

Meteorological agencies continue to track Typhoon Bavi’s movement and intensity. Residents are urged to remain vigilant and follow official instructions for safety. The storm’s heavy rainfall is expected to persist, increasing the risk of flash floods and landslides, particularly in mountainous and low-lying regions.

The economic impact of Typhoon Bavi could be substantial. Damage to infrastructure, agriculture, and businesses is anticipated, affecting the livelihoods of many people. Recovery efforts will require significant resources and coordination among local, regional, and national authorities.
